ECNEC okays 12 development projects worth Tk 71.5b

ECNEC sent back the 'land registration automation project' for further review

The government on Monday gave the nod to 12 development projects, including four revised schemes, involving a total of Tk 71.50 billion.

The Executive Committee of the National Economic Council (ECNEC) approved the eight fresh projects, two revised ones and extended execution time for two others at its meeting with Chief Adviser Professor Muhammad Yunus in the chair.

The entire amount of the combined cost will be financed from the government's own resources. The ECNEC meeting, however, sent back the "Land registration automation project" for further review. After the meeting, Planning Adviser Dr Wahiduddin Mahmud or any representatives from the government has not briefed journalist about the outcome of the ECNEC meeting.

The newly approved eight projects include "Important Rural Infrastructure Development in Manikganj District" at a cost of Tk 4.50 billion, "Rural Infrastructure Development in Satkhira District" for Tk 19.30 billion, "Improvement of Small Irrigation System in Haor Areas of Kishoreganj and Netrokona Districts" for Tk 1.65 billion, "Infrastructure Development of Gazipur Agricultural University" for Tk 5.67 billion, the "Integrated Development for Operational Management of the Directorate of Health Education, NIPORT and Directorate of Nursing & Midwifery project" for Tk 2.12 billion, "Implementation of Essential Remaining Activities of PFD, HEF, IFM, HRD and SWPMM" for Tk 15.46 billion, "Construction of 'B'-Type Officers' Residential Buildings at Nirjhor Residential Area, Dhaka Cantonment" for Tk 1.78 billion, and the "Implementation of the Remaining Activities of Essential Family Planning, Maternal, Child and Reproductive Health Services under the 4th Sector Programme" for Tk 2.11 billion.

The two revised projects are the "BSCIC Industrial Park, Tangail (3rd revised)" with an additional cost of Tk 394.3 million and "Establishment of One Engineering College in Each of Chattogram, Khulna, Rajshahi and Rangpur Divisions (2nd revised)" with an additional cost of Tk 3.95 billion.

The execution tenure of the two other projects was extended without increasing the cost. They are: the "Construction of Kalia Bridge over Nabaganga River at the 21st Kilometer of Narail-Kalia District Highway" for Tk 1.36 billion, and the "Construction of Independence Monument at Suhrawardy Udyan, Dhaka (Phase 3) (1st revised)" for Tk 3.97 billion.

In addition, the ECNEC meeting was informed about nine projects which cost below Tk 500 million and were approved by the planning adviser. The planning adviser has the authority to approve projects worth Tk 500 million or below without sending those to the ECNEC.
